When It’s Time to Get Your A/c Repaired
Is the level of convenience in your home falling short of what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if ignored, could result in more extreme repair work or the need for an early replacement of your a/c unit. While a system that won’t turn on is a clear sign that you require repair work, there are other, less obvious problems. If you recognize with the more subtle indicators of a problem with your cooling, you will be able to call a professional service expert faster rather than later on.
If any of the following use, one of our Missouri AC repair professionals advises that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an increase in the amount of cash needed to spend for your monthly energy expenses: Inefficient operation of your ac system can be caused by a number of various concerns, including leaking ductwork, an internal breakdown, or a faulty thermostat. This indicates that it has to work harder to keep your property cool, which will result in a significant increase in the amount that you pay in utility costs.
- You just notice h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, make sure you haven’t inadvertently set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ature level by checking it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a issue on the within your ac system, and you should get it inspected by a expert.
- You are seeing a greater humidity level at your residential or commercial property: Even though this is not the main function of your air conditioning system, it is responsible for managing the humidity level inside of your home or industrial structure. Higher humidity shows that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can cause the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is important that you get this matter dealt with as rapidly as humanly possible, particularly for the sake of your security.
- The airflow in your unit is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ide array of factors that can lead to insufficient airflow. We will need to perform a extensive inspection in order to figure out whether the problem is the outcome of a blocked air filter, an issue with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or obstructed duct.
- You observe that there is a considerable quantity of moisture in the location around your unit: Condensation is a natural event, nevertheless it should not be present in extreme amounts.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a blocked drain tube if you notice any excess wetness or pooling water in the area.
- Unusual Noises from Your Unit: It is to be anticipated for an a/c unit to develop some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ible shrieking,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an apparent indication that something requires to be repaired.
- It appears that there is a problem with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your a/c. If you have cold and hot locations around your home, your unit will not sh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your system won’t begin, it could also be since it will not turn off.
- Foul odors are originating from your system: There may be a issue with your air conditioner if you smell anything burning or a musty smell. These smells can be caused by a range of factors, consisting of mold development and charred circuitry.
- Your system rotates often in between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have picked on the thermostat, air conditioning system are configured to turn off automatically. Despite this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something wrong with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few noises that ought to not be heard coming from a/c unit despite the fact that they do not operate completely silence. These noises might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king noise. These particular sounds generally suggest that there is a issue within the cooling unit that has to be repaired by a professional of in Platte County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ioner The following should be included:
- Banging: The issue is generally the compressor in an a/c unit that is making a banging noise. This component of the air conditioning system is responsible for providing refrigerant to the different other elements of the unit in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or parts may loosen up as the AC system ages. This sound is caused by the parts walking around and rattling and crashing one another.
- Screeching: A broken blower fan motor within the a/c may produce a sound comparable to screeching or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Usually, a malfunctioning f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Switch off the air conditioning right now and get in touch with a professional for repairs whenever you hear a screeching sound.
-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never a excellent indication to hear coming from any sort of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or might have worn, which may result in this grinding noise originating from the AC.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it generally indicates that the compressor itself needs to be replaced. The complete air conditioner unit could need to be replaced depending upon the model of AC and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is really typical for an air conditioning unit to make a clicking sound when it at first tur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ole period of the cooling cycle, then there is a problem with the clicking. These clicks are the outcome of a thermostat that is not working properly.
